Is there a rule of thumb on how many turns out you start with after a cleaning? I know the manual says like 1 1/2 . 81 CSR 1000

You start there then turn 1/4 one way or the other waiting 10 seconds in between for the carb to catch up. Once I get them where nothing changes, I rev it arouns 2500-3000 and take out the miss ether lean or rich.
That's how I do it.
